Source: Table by Simon Bowler of 2nd Market Capital, Data compiled from S&P Global Market ...The midsized retail REIT has a short track record having gone public in 2021, but PECO looks like one of the more reliable stocks that pay monthly dividends. Grocery chains such as Kroger, Publix, and Safeway account for around one-third of PECO's rent, providing a stable source of cash flow and reliable foot traffic for surrounding tenants ...

Source: Table by Simon Bowler of 2nd Market Capital, Data compiled from S&P Global Market ...Granite REIT is a spin-off of Magna International which still continues to be its major tenant. Magna accounts for ~60% of Granite’s total revenues. Granite REIT has a diversified yet balanced geographical presence in Canada (26% of revenue), U.S. (31%), Austria (27%), and Europe (15%).Jan 13, 2022 · The mortgage REIT cut its dividend in 2020, but continued to make monthly payments to shareholders.
